Sidney Road is in Woodford Halse, Daventry and in West Northamptonshire district. NN11 3RP is located in the Woodford and Weedon elect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Daventry. This postcode has been in use since 1993-08-01.

Is Sidney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Sidney Road was 19.3 per 1,000 residents, which is 72.3% lower than the Daventry West average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Sidney Road has the 5th lowest crime rate of 27 local areas in Daventry West and the 153rd lowest crime rate of 1,265 local areas in West Northamptonshire .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 7.7 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 3.2%.
